The god Hapi

The god Hapi... was the god of the Nile among the ancient Egyptians. The Nile is one of the symbols of Egypt and connects Upper and Lower Egypt. Therefore, the mural in the Luxor Temple depicted “Hapi” holding the rope connecting the Upper and Lower Egypt. The god “Hapi” was a symbol of the unity of the state at that time.
